## Support

The Fennwright UI kit vendors all third-party fonts under `assets/fonts/` with licenses checked in beside each family. Support staff should not advise customers to swap in alternative font files, as this breaks the render-hash verification step. For licensing questions, missing glyph reports, or requests to add a new typeface, forward the ticket details to the address below.

escalation mailbox, hadug-bajog: sormir@norvalabs.internal

# ---------------------------------------------------------
# ATTN ON-CALL: clock skew on Vellmore build agents.
# Agents fleet-c and fleet-d drifted ~40s last cycle; NTP
# daemon was pinned to the dead Harkwell pool. Signed build
# attestations will fail validation until skew < 5s. Do not
# bump token TTLs as a workaround — fix the clocks. Restart
# chronyd after repointing to the Ostrander pool. Signing
# still requires the agent credential, set on the next line.

vault entry, yahif-yajep: COURIER_KEY29=b802bdf8034096b65a51c6ba5abe2

Runbook: Graniteway API — account recovery

Pagination: cursor-based only; `next` token opaque, expires in 15 min. Reviewers: reject offset params in new endpoints. Max page size 200, default 50. Recovery of a locked service account requires the admin console plus the passphrase that follows.

unlock words, hahip-baduf: holwyn-istath-julvan

**Ticket QLNT-482: Signature check failing on sqlstyle-rules package**

New team members: the Querybright CI pipeline verifies every release of our SQL linting ruleset before it reaches the shared runner. Last night's build of sqlstyle-rules v2.9 failed verification because the pipeline was still pinned to the retired March key. The fix is to update the trusted-keys manifest. For reference, the currently valid signing key is shown below.

release key, tajep-hahog: bky9_1rP9oCRtF

## Tuning

The Farebox pricing experiment splits traffic across three price tiers for the Quillgate venue network. Do not ship a release that changes tier ratios without resetting the experiment epoch — stale assignments skew revenue attribution. Rollout gates are controlled by the constants in this section. Cache TTLs must stay shorter than the assignment window. If the holdout fraction drops below five percent, abort. The active tuning constants are as follows.

tuning table, fawip-fahag:
WEIGHTS = {
    "novwyn": 452,
    "casdor": 675,
}